7. Communications

7.1 Web Management Card

Tripp Lite's WEBCARDLXMINI is an optional accessory available for all models.
The WEBCARDLXMINI card enables remote monitoring and control through
several interfaces: HTML5 web via HTTP(S), menu/CLI via SSH/Telnet, and SNMP
for integration with software management platforms, such as DCIM. Using
WEBCARDLXMINI in your UPS combined with Tripp Lite's network-enabled switched
PDUs, you can manage power throughout your facility and receive automated alerts
to identify problems before they cause downtime.
WEBCARDLXMINI also supports a family of sensors for remotely monitoring
environmental conditions. You can link up to three sensors together, connecting them
to a single port on the WEBCARDLXMINI. Tripp Lite offers free PowerAlert
Management System software. Learn more and download at tripplite.com/products/
power-alert.

7.2 Relay Card (Coming Soon)
A 10-pin terminal supports a relay card to provide bypass, utility failure, inverter on, battery low, UPS fault, UPS alarm and UPS
shutdown functions.
The relay communication card contains six dry contact outputs and one dry input. The inputs and outputs are factory
programmed according to functions listed in the following table.
